Photo Source: Amnesty By Naveed Qazi | Editor, Globe Up Front Whenever there has been a military junta ruling a country, and making amendments to the constitution, a repression is almost inevitable. The regime in Thailand seems one of those brutish examples: the Thai regime had attained power in May 2014. Before this, 2006 military coup made news headlines. A year later, in March 2015, Prime Minister Prayut Chan-Ocha replaced the Martial Law Act of 1914, with Section 44, which made him enjoy full impunity, without any accountability from the judiciary, administration and the legislature. The Thai government, in their official narratives, argues about the freedom, they have given to their people, through the constitution, most notably, in the 1997 amendment of the Constitution, which guarantees an addition of forty rights, as compared to fewer rights that were drafted in the 1932 Constitution.
